The Thornbury export service streams rows into the spreadsheet writer rather than buffering whole worksheets, so local memory use should stay under 512 MB even for large tenants. When reviewing changes to the exporter, please verify that no code path calls `collect_all_rows`, since that reintroduces full buffering and was the cause of the earlier out-of-memory incidents. To reproduce locally, seed the fixtures with `make seed-exports`, then run the service against the development database using the connection string below.

warehouse DSN: mssql://rusdor_svc:0FSWCn9@db-951a.paliqforge.local:5432/ulawyn

The blue-green cutover logic here looks correct, but the drain window for the Pellwright billing worker is doing double duty: it gates both queue drain and health-probe stabilization. Those should be separate knobs, since invoice settlement can legitimately take longer than probe convergence. Also, the rollback trigger fires on a single failed probe, which is too aggressive for this worker's startup profile. I'd split the timing values out explicitly; my proposal follows.

tuning table, kahop-tawig:
CAPS = {
    "aldix": 1008,
    "oliax": 81,
    "casok": 299,
    "sordor": 409,
    "sormir": 822,
}

## Runbook: Fernloop calendar sync conflicts

When Fernloop detects overlapping edits from two sources, it pauses the sync pair and queues both versions for arbitration. Do not clear the queue manually; the reconciler replays events in order once the pair is resumed. Reviewers should verify that conflict resolution honors the last-writer rule per source tier. The reconciler reads the following configuration at startup.

settings of tagef-bawif:
DRUIX_HOST=druix.zemvarlabs.internal
DRUIX_PORT=8000

## Further reading

Farecraft is the rules engine that computes shipping fees for Tollwright checkout. Rules are authored in a restricted DSL; no arbitrary code execution, no network calls from rule bodies. Reviewers should focus on the rule-upload path and the signing of published rule bundles. The DSL grammar, sandbox constraints, and the bundle-signing design are documented on the internal page here:

wiki page, tahaf-tajog: https://jira.ordindyn.corp/pipeline